India’s drone ecosystem just got a major boost. Raphe mPhibr, a Noida-based drone startup, has secured a whopping $100 million in Series B funding, marking a pivotal moment for the country’s defense tech ambitions. The investment, led by General Catalyst, values the company at nearly $250 million and signals a new era for indigenous UAV innovation as India ramps up its military tech spending.
Raphe mPhibr isn’t just another drone manufacturer. The company is behind the mR10, touted as the world’s first operational drone swarm, and the mR10-IC VTOL, which can stay airborne for up to 180 minutes thanks to its hybrid engine. These drones are built for real-world challenges—think ISR missions with 100km range, logistics drops in tough terrain, and maritime patrols. Their tech stack includes AI-powered detection, swarm capabilities, and robust performance in harsh conditions.
The military UAV market in India is on a tear, with projections suggesting it could hit up to $4 billion by 2030. Factors like defense modernization, border security, and the government’s “Make in India” push are fueling this growth. Local players such as Raphe mPhibr are stepping up, ready to challenge global competitors and reduce reliance on imports.
With over 1,800 UAVs already manufactured and more than 158,000 kilometers flown, Raphe mPhibr is well-positioned to ride the wave of defense tech innovation. The new funding is set to accelerate their roadmap—expect more advanced models, deeper R&D, and expanded production lines. For India’s defense sector and tech ecosystem, this is a win that could reshape the UAV landscape for years to come.
